
Bhopal Hamidia Gurudwara: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an, who arrived to pay obeisance at the Gurdwara at Hamidia Road in Bhopal, the capital of Madhya Pradesh, ordered a major action on the spot, in fact, there is a Rajput bar and hotel near the Gurdwara, where there is a gathering of alcoholics till late night, daily. Devotees coming to pay obeisance at the Gurdwara had to face trouble many times due to the elements standing outside the hotel. On Monday, when the Chief Minister arrived to attend a religious event organized at this Gurdwara, the Sikh Sangat requested him to close this bar, which resulted in the closure of the bar. Later, on the spot, CM Shivraj ordered the officials to close the bar immediately. After some time, the administration’s staff reached to take action to seal this bar and hotel.
“Veer Bal Diwas”
Significantly, the country is celebrating the first “Veer Bal Diwas” today, Shivraj government of Madhya Pradesh has taken a big decision on this occasion, Madhya Pradesh government will celebrate it as a week.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an made this announcement today after paying obeisance at Gurudwara Nanaksar, Hamidia Road, Bhopal on this occasion.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an said that in reality today is the real Veer Bal Diwas. That’s why Prime Minister Narendra Modi has decided and we have also decided in Madhya Pradesh that “Veer Bal Diwas” will be celebrated every year from 21 to 26 January. It is noteworthy that on January 9, 2022, Prime Minister Narendra Modi had announced to celebrate “Veer Bal Diwas” on December 26, the birth anniversary of Guru Gobind Singh. He had said that it has been decided to celebrate the martyrdom day of Baba Zorawar Singh and Baba Fateh Singh, the younger Sahibzads of Guru Gobind Singh ji, as “Veer Bal Diwas”. Under the same decision, “Veer Bal Diwas” is being celebrated in the country today.
